abstract="Injury is the leading cause of death among children aged 2-17 years. A legislative study commission--the North Carolina Child Fatality Task Force--was established in 1991 to study the causes of child deaths and to make recommendations to prevent future deaths. Aspects of the legislative response are presented here.<p /> <p>Language: en</p>",
